Understanding Laptop Batteries
Laptop batteries, particularly those in Asus laptops, are made of lithium-ion cells. These cells are designed to provide a high energy density, making them ideal for portable devices. However, lithium-ion batteries have a limited number of charge cycles before their capacity starts to degrade. A charge cycle is a full discharge followed by a full recharge. Most laptop batteries can handle around 300 to 500 charge cycles before their capacity drops to 80% of its original value.

Charging Your Laptop Overnight
One common question among laptop users is whether it’s safe to charge their devices overnight. The answer is yes, but with some caveats. Modern laptops, including those from Asus, have built-in charging controllers that prevent overcharging. Once the battery is fully charged, the controller stops the charging process, and the laptop starts to use power directly from the adapter.
However, leaving your laptop plugged in all the time can cause the battery to degrade faster. This is because the battery is constantly being charged and discharged, which can lead to increased wear and tear. If you need to use your laptop for extended periods, it’s recommended to unplug the power adapter when the battery is fully charged and use the battery power until it reaches around 20% capacity.
Best Practices for Charging Your Asus Laptop
To get the most out of your Asus laptop’s battery, follow these best practices:
When your laptop’s battery level falls below 20%, it’s a good idea to charge it. Avoid letting the battery completely discharge to 0% on a regular basis, as this can reduce its lifespan.
If you’re not using your laptop for an extended period, it’s recommended to store the battery with a 50% charge. This will help slow down the degradation process and keep the battery healthy.
Avoid extreme temperatures when charging your laptop. High temperatures can cause the battery to degrade faster, while low temperatures can reduce its capacity.
Monitoring Your Laptop’s Battery Health
Asus laptops come with built-in tools to monitor the battery’s health. You can check the battery’s capacity, charge cycles, and overall health using the Asus Battery Health Charging software. This software can also help you adjust your charging habits to extend the battery’s lifespan.

How can I monitor my Asus laptop’s battery health to optimize its performance?
Monitoring your Asus laptop’s battery health is essential to optimize its performance and identify any potential issues before they become major problems. You can use built-in tools, such as the Windows Battery Report or third-party software, to monitor your battery’s capacity, charge cycles, and overall health. These tools can provide valuable insights into your battery’s performance and help you identify any issues that may be affecting its lifespan.
To access the Windows Battery Report, press the Windows key + R and type “cmd” to open the Command Prompt. Then, type “powercfg /batteryreport” and press Enter. This will generate a detailed report on your battery’s health, including its capacity, charge cycles, and usage patterns. You can also use third-party software, such as BatteryMon or Coconut Battery, to monitor your battery’s health and receive alerts when its capacity falls below a certain threshold. By regularly monitoring your battery’s health, you can take proactive steps to optimize its performance and extend its lifespan.
What are the most common mistakes that can reduce my Asus laptop’s battery life?
One of the most common mistakes that can reduce your Asus laptop’s battery life is overcharging or undercharging your battery. Lithium-ion batteries are designed to be used and not kept at full charge for extended periods. Constantly keeping your battery at 100% capacity can cause it to degrade faster, while undercharging can reduce its overall capacity. Another common mistake is exposing your laptop to extreme temperatures, which can affect the battery’s performance and lifespan.
Other mistakes that can reduce your Asus laptop’s battery life include using low-quality or counterfeit chargers, which can damage your battery or laptop. Additionally, failing to update your power management software and BIOS can prevent your laptop from taking advantage of the latest power-saving features and optimizations.
